This lively sketch is a modello or riccordo for the overdoor formerly in the Conference Room of the Residenz, Munich, depicting one of a set of The Four Continents, which were destroyed during the Second World War. Anna Paola Zugni-Tauro dates these paintings to 1717, and further notes that when this room was redecorated by François Cuvilliés in 1730, he might have reincorporated the overdoors into the new scheme, tempering his designs to fit with the existing canvas (see A.P. Zugni-Tauro, Gaspare Diziani, Venice, 1971, p. 105, pl. 7).
